Dubai Marriage Leave: Eligibility checklist explained

July 19, 2025 | Dubai, UAE: Regarding the Dubai Marriage Leave, in a milestone move to harmonize family life and enhance personal happiness, His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, signed the new decree to allow official Dubai marriage leave for UAE government workers.

The decree, effective from 1 January 2025, provides eligible Emirati staff with 10 days of full pay marriage leave. The policy ensures the psychological and social balance of married couples as well as complements the UAE’s overall initiative to promote family values and offer nurturing working environments in the public sector of the UAE.

The Dubai marriage leave policy also applies to Emirati civil servants, special development and free zone authorities—like the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C). It also applies to members of the Emirati judiciary and armed forces deployed within the emirate.

The government has assured that this step in the right direction is being taken to foster family harmony and facilitate young Emiratis to start their marriage with more emotional and practical assistance.

Conditions and Entitlements Under Dubai Marriage Leave Policy

Emirati workers seeking Dubai marriage leave must satisfy the following conditions:

  • The applicant must be a Dubai government employee or associated institution or be an Emirati national.
  • The spouse of the employee must be a UAE national.
  • The employee should have finished the probation period of his organization without any complaints.
  • The marriage contract should have been duly attested by the relevant UAE authority and should have been signed after December 31, 2024.

During availing the authorized Dubai marriage leave, the employees are eligible for their gross salary in full inclusive of all allowances and monetary benefits admissible under his relevant human resources law.

The leave can be taken continuously or periodically, and the liberty is given to the employees to schedule the leave as per family and personal needs. The employee is entitled to take the days of leave within one year from the date of marriage.

The government departments also authorize carrying Dubai marriage leave forward to the subsequent calendar year if the employee provides corroborative reasons and takes approval from his/her immediate supervisor.

Job Security, Flexibility, and Exceptional Cases Handled

Government departments never allow recalling of employees during their Dubai marriage leave duration, promoting uninterrupted personal time—except for military staff. Military employees can be recalled during the leave period. Recall period is served by military employees after which they can resume unused Dubai marriage leave.

Apart from this, if an employee is summoned for national or reserve duty while on Dubai marriage leave or is not able to avail the leave because of such obligations, then such unavailed days may be brought forward. This being said, these days should be availed within a year of resumption of work for duty.

Interestingly, the decree protects marriage leave benefits for government job transfers. Where an employee is transferred or reposted to some other government department before the date on which he or she would have taken his or her marriage leave, the employee is entitled to the remaining number of days that fall within the cover of the Dubai marriage leave policy.

This measure reflects Dubai’s growing emphasis on human capital, social development, and sustainable employee well-being. By supporting young Emiratis at the onset of married life, the government reaffirms its role in promoting social cohesion alongside professional fulfillment.

The Dubai Government Human Resources Department has welcomed the decision and will begin integrating the marriage leave provisions into internal HR frameworks across public sector bodies in preparation for implementation in 2025.

Government officials mentioned that the decree is part of national efforts towards empowering Emiratis by providing them with integrated work and family support systems.
